【pg_client_windows86】是针对Windows 86平台的PostgreSQL客户端软件包,主要用于在ArcMap中连接和操作PostgreSQL数据库。这个压缩包包含了所有必要的组件,使得用户能够在Windows环境下与PostgreSQL 9.1版本的服务器进行交互。下面我们将详细探讨其中涉及的关键知识点。 1. **PostgreSQL**: PostgreSQL是一款开源的对象关系型数据库管理系统(ORDBMS),它以其强大的功能、高度的稳定性和严格的标准遵循而受到全球开发者的广泛认可。9.1是PostgreSQL的一个版本,尽管可能不如最新的版本功能丰富,但在某些场合下,特别是对系统稳定性有特定需求时,依然会被选用。 2. **Windows 86**: 这通常指的是适用于32位(x86)Windows操作系统的软件。尽管现在64位系统更为常见,但32位系统仍然有一部分用户,因此32位版本的客户端工具是必要的。 3. **ArcMap**: ArcMap是Esri公司的ArcGIS产品线的一部分,是一个用于地理信息系统(GIS)的桌面应用程序。它允许用户查看、编辑和分析地理数据,并且可以连接到各种类型的数据库,包括PostgreSQL,以获取和操作空间数据。 4. **PostgreSQL客户端**: 客户端软件是用户与PostgreSQL数据库进行交互的工具,包括数据查询、插入、更新、删除等操作。此压缩包中的客户端可能包含命令行工具如psql,以及图形用户界面(GUI)工具,使非技术用户也能方便地使用。 5. **连接配置**: 使用pg_client_windows86连接PostgreSQL服务器时,需要知道服务器地址(IP或域名)、端口号(默认为5432)、数据库名、用户名和密码。这些信息一般会在连接字符串或ArcMap的数据库连接属性中设置。 6. **SQL语言**: SQL(结构化查询语言)是与数据库交互的标准语言。通过PostgreSQL客户端,用户可以编写SQL语句来执行各种数据库操作,如创建表、查询数据、修改记录等。 7. **安全与权限管理**: 在连接和操作数据库时,理解数据库的权限模型至关重要。PostgreSQL支持角色和权限的概念,允许管理员控制不同用户对数据库资源的访问权限。 8. **备份与恢复**: 客户端工具通常也提供数据库的备份和恢复功能,这对于数据的安全性和灾难恢复至关重要。用户可以利用pg_dump和pg_restore命令行工具进行数据的备份和恢复。 9. **性能优化**: 使用客户端工具时,了解如何优化查询性能和数据库配置对于提升系统效率有很大帮助。这可能涉及到索引创建、查询优化、数据库参数调整等方面。 10. **数据导入导出**: 数据的导入导出也是客户端常用的功能之一。例如,可以将CSV或其他格式的数据导入到PostgreSQL数据库,或者将数据库数据导出为文件。 总结,【pg_client_windows86】是面向32位Windows用户的一款PostgreSQL连接工具,它使得用户能够通过ArcMap等GIS软件便捷地与PostgreSQL 9.1数据库进行数据交互,涵盖了从基本的SQL操作到高级的数据库管理和性能优化等多个方面的功能。在使用过程中,理解并掌握相关的数据库知识和操作技巧,对于提升工作效率和保证数据安全都至关重要。
- 1
- 粉丝: 0
- 资源: 13
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- HBuilderX.1.9.4.20190426.zip
- 这是一幅中秋主题图片,意在表达中秋节节日氛围
- 这是一幅国庆主题图片,意在表达国庆节节日氛围
- C#基础语法 while和do...while循环语句
- 计算机二级考试备考需要充分了解考试内容与形式、制定合理的备考计划、掌握有效的备考技巧、保持良好心态以及关注考试动态
- 在VB.NET中处理数据结构是构建高效应用程序的关键部分,这里例举了VB.NET中一些常用的数据结构
- 24秋新生任务书.zip
- C、C++项目开发资源.docx
- SolidWorksAddinStudy-solidworks
- termux-install-linux-kali linux安装教程
- 1
- 2
前往页